The topic here is simple, this thread is a simple debate on the community's views on private militias in Western Society.
Particularly the type of militias that have sprang up in a rapid fashion throughout countries like the U.S. in recent years.
All I am looking for is some honest opinions, whatever they maybe on the matter in your own words, not links to news articles.
I will start with mine:
I feel that the U.S. media has done great strides to demonize private militias forming all around the U.S. And that Congress has scoffed at the idea dispite the rise in the forming of militias.
Furthermore, I also see that many of the miltias seemed to be composed of individuals who really don't have any clear purpose, and that the mere participation in a militia seems to be almost for a recreational purpose.
Thus Far I also notice that many of the privately started militias are really, at least in my experiance with them, just harmless, composed mainly if not in some rare cases entirely of ex military or law enforcement personel, who for the most part take no interest in disrupting our society or in any acts of violence. And really seem and often state that they just wish to help better their communities, participate in preaching and spreading awareness of the rights given by the U.S. Constitution in a nonvoilent fashion.
HOWEVER,
Another more alarming trend I have noticed in the expolsion of private militas in my country at least, is that a very small number does seek out and encourage armed confrontation with government on almost any level, and a number of these "3 percenters" are based off racial or ethnic hatred for their core values.
It's these small number of radicals that not only seems to put the idea (which actually is cemented into law since the founding of this country) of a private civilian militia in the unnessary and negative media and government spotlight. But seems to jepordize many rights we now enjoy via the protection offered by the U.S. Constitution.
Any thoughts on the matter of armed private militas in Western Soceity?
Also note by private, I do not mean corporate sponsored, or in anyway affiliated with a business, I mean by average citizens who are not or no longer assosiated with traditional military or law enforcment services.
